首页 > 解决方案 > 通过 npm 安装卡住,它挂起

问题描述

我知道这个问题已经在不同的地方被多次询问,但没有一个有效。我尝试过的事情:

  1. npm 配置 rm 代理

  2. npm config rm https-proxy

  3. npm 缓存验证

  4. 使用 NPM,NODE (6.14.6, 12.16.3):卡在

    [........] /rollbackfailedoptional
    Err: ETIMEDOUT

  5. 升级 NODE 12.16.3->15.5 和 NPM 6.14.6->7.3:卡在

    [.......] /idealTree:weather: 窗台 IdealTree builddeps

  6. npm 配置设置注册表http://registry.npmjs.org/

  7. 尝试删除 package-lock.json

  8. 我已经为信息启用了日志级别;多次重启设备

目前最新运行的快照在这里。一切正常,然后卡住了。我可以访问 chrome 上的网站。在 Ubuntu 上工作。

https://i.stack.imgur.com/zB04y.png

标签: node.jsreactjsnpm

解决方案


连接使用使用 4G 移动连接的移动 USB 网络共享。虽然网站在浏览器中打开,但我不知道为什么它无法从 npm 下载包。所有上述解决方案都已完成,但幸运的是它没有破坏安装。我从 4G 移动连接切换到 wifi,但仍然使用 USB 网络共享,并且它适用于新版本的 NPM 和 NODEJS。最后,似乎问题毕竟与连接有关。“NPM”可能需要以最小的丢包率持续可靠的连接,并且浏览器可能已经处理了更多的丢包率。


推荐阅读